Color Name: Arsenic

What is hex #334641 Color?

Arsenic (Hex code: 334641)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#334641 is Arsenic. The RGB values are (51, 70, 65) which means it is composed of 27% red, 38% green and 35%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:27 M:0 Y:7 K:73. In the HSV/HSB scale, #334641 has a hue of 164°, 27% saturation and a brightness value of 27%.

Hex #334641 Color Palettes

Complementary color palette of 334641. Complementary color is 463338

Complementary Palette

The complement of #334641 is #463338 which is called Old Burgundy.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#334641 color is offered by #463338.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

Analogous color palette with (334641, 334246 and 334638)

Analogous Palette

The analogous colors of #334641 are #334246 and #334638, called Arsenic and Kombu Green, respectively. In the RGB color wheel, they are located to the right and left of #334641 with a 30° separation. An analogous color palette is extremely soothing to the eyes and works wonders if your main color is soft or pastel.

Split Complementary color palette with (334641, 463342 and 463833)

Split-Complementary Palette

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#334641 are #463342 (Dark Puce) and #463833 (Dark Lava).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.

Triadic color palette with (334641, 413346 and 464133)

Triadic Palette

#334641 triadic color palette has three colors each of which is separated by 120° in the RGB wheel. Thus, #413346 (Onyx) and #464133 (Dark Lava) along with #334641, our main color, create a stunning and beautiful triadic palette with the maximum variation in hue and, therefore, offering the best possible contrast when taken together.
